Linear Exapanders
Linear expanders are a continuous wave formed wire length produce from spring tempered materials. They act as a load bearing device having approximately the same load/deflection characteristics as a wave spring.
Axial pressure is obtained by lying the expander flat in a straight line. Linear expanders are available cut to length or as a continuous coil, for the user to cut as needed.
Marcel Expanders
Expanders can also be formed in a circle. The expander will provide radial force or outward pressure.
These can be used behind seals to energize them when no pressure is available.
A Marcel expander can also be used for tolerance take up or to self center an assembly.
